<p>PROBLEM TO BE SOLVED: To provide a flexible printed circuit which achieves a good high-speed signal transmission property without sacrificing flexibility, and to provide a method for manufacturing such a flexible printed circuit.SOLUTION: A flexible printed circuit 100 comprises: a first unit substrate 10 having a first insulator layer 11 made of a liquid crystal polymer, a signal-transmission circuit 12 for high-frequency signal use formed on one face 11a of the first insulator layer 11, and a first conductive layer 13 formed on the other face 11b; a second unit substrate 20 having a second insulator layer 21 made of the liquid crystal polymer, and a second conductive layer 23 formed on one face 21a of the second insulator layer 21; and an adhesive layer 30 made of a thermoplastic adhesive agent of a modified polyphenylene ether resin which glues the first unit substrate 10 and the second unit substrate 20 together so that the one face 11a of the first insulator layer 11 is opposed to the other face 21b of the second insulator layer 21.</p> |
